Programs of Study
CFCC offers a variety of educational options to meet your academic and training needs. Programs of Study range in number of credits and time-to-completion requirements, and fall into the following categories:

- The Associate in Science degree (AS) is designed for students who wish to enter the workforce in a skilled field. Some limited transfer into bachelor’s degree programs is available.
- The College Credit certificate provides students with technical skills required for a specific area of study. Each college credit certificate applies to a corresponding Associate in Science degree program.
- The Applied Technology diploma (AT) provides students with entry-level courses in a specific area of study. These courses can usually be applied toward an Associate in Science degree program.
- The Postsecondary Adult Vocation certificates (PSAV) provides students with broad entry-level courses and technical skills in a specific area of study. Many of these certificates can be applied to a corresponding Associate in Science degree program.
